3
Q

Crawling

A

process of bots (robots) or

spiders scanning web pages

4
Q

Indexing

A

relevant key words and phrases are

catalogued

5
Q

Ranking / Scoring

A

involves the sorting of web pages in the

indexed pages

6
Q

Query request and results serving

A

when the user types his

‘request’ or query into the search engine

Q

Affiliate Marketing

A

commission-based arrangement where referring sites

receive a commission on sales or leads by merchants sites

12
Q

Interactive Display Advertising

A

appear on publisher or social media sites and consist
of banner ads that are paid-for, using graphics that accomplish brand
awareness and encourage purchase by the visitor.

13
Q

Opt-in Email

A

involves direct communication with individual who have agreed
in advance, to receive communication from a specific company
